What is the purpose of uncoupling agents like 2,4-dinitrophenol (DNP)?
To increase ATP production
To stop the flow of electrons
To allow protons to bypass ATP synthase and reduce ATP synthesis
To speed up the electron transport chain

Explanation

Uncoupling agents disrupt the proton gradient, leading to reduced ATP synthesis.
